Formaldehyde regulations for the EU market
Furniture and wood-based articles placed on the EU market will have to meet a formaldehyde emission limit of 0.062 mg/m³ after 6 August 2026 under Commission Regulation (EU) 2023/1464. Source: Fordaq The regulation amends Annex XVII of REACH by adding Entry 77 for formaldehyde and formaldehyde-releasing substances. Under the new entry, articles may not be placed on the EU market after 6 August 2026 if, under the specified test conditions, the concentration of formaldehyde released from those articles exceeds 0.062 mg/m³ for furniture and wood-based articles. For articles other than furniture and wood-based articles, the limit is 0.080 mg/m³. The European Commission states that formaldehyde-based resins are used in the production of a wide variety of articles and that their primary use is in wood-based panels, where they act as a bonding agent for wood particles. The regulation also refers to other wood-based products, including furniture and flooring. In the regulation, the Commission says wood-based panels, articles made of wood-based panels or other wood-based articles, and furniture containing wood or other materials are among the main sources of formaldehyde emissions in indoor air where formaldehyde other than naturally occurring formaldehyde is used during production. Appendix 14 sets the reference conditions for measuring formaldehyde released into indoor air from covered articles. The regulation specifies test chamber conditions including a temperature of 23 ± 0.5°C, relative humidity of 45 ± 3%, a loading factor of 1 ± 0.02 m²/m³ and an air exchange rate of 1 ± 0.05 h-1. The steady-state concentration measured in the test chamber is used to verify compliance with the formaldehyde limit. The restriction does not apply to articles in which formaldehyde or formaldehyde-releasing substances are exclusively naturally present in the materials from which the articles are produced. The regulation also lists exemptions for articles exclusively for outdoor use, certain construction articles used outside the building shell and vapour barrier, articles exclusively for industrial or professional use unless they lead to exposure of the general public, food-contact articles, and second-hand articles.

Metsa moves to Milan for a better design
Metsa has opened a new packaging design studio in Milan, Italy to accelerate packaging development especially in its key European markets. The new studio enables earlier and closer collaboration between Metsä Board and its customers, allowing joint testing and refinement to bring real-world-ready packaging solutions faster. Source: Timberbiz Packaging is no longer just about protection and logistics. Brands are under increasing pressure to reduce material use, replace fossil-based materials, meet tightening regulations and still deliver strong shelf impact. At the same time, expectations for speed have fundamentally changed: solutions must be developed faster, with greater certainty around performance, recyclability and compliance. Metsä Board is addressing this shift with this new design studio in Milan bringing together design, material expertise and data-driven insights. It enables customers to develop packaging solutions that are more efficient and fit to their requirements. “Milan offers a unique combination of a strong packaging ecosystem and a world-class design environment. Being there allows us to work more closely with our customers and strengthen collaboration across key European markets,” said Erja Hyrsky, SVP Commercial Operations. By combining AI-supported design, simulation possibilities and material expertise, solutions can be explored and tested much earlier in the process, reducing uncertainty, accelerating decision-making and shortening development cycles. “Our customers don’t just need new packaging ideas – they need solutions that are validated for actual use conditions, and they need them faster than ever. By combining design, materials and data, we can move from concept to validated solution much earlier, with greater confidence,” said Erja Hyrsky. The Milan studio is built for a new way of working. Instead of sequential development, design, materials and performance are advanced in parallel, making it possible to improve material efficiency while maintaining performance requirements. “Instead of developing solutions in isolation, we can test and refine them together, making sure they are ready for market introduction much earlier,” said Ilkka Harju, Packaging Services Director. “For brands in segments such as food, pharma and beauty, where packaging plays a critical role both functionally and commercially, this integrated approach is becoming essential.”
